MUSICAL AFTERNOON
Y.M.C.A. BOYS'. DIVISION The lounge of the Y.M.C.A. presented a very pleasing appearance recently when a musical afternoon was held, the object being to raise funds for equipment for the use of .the boys. The president (Mrs. H. E. Brooker) welcomed the large gathering of members and friends, and thanked them for their interest in the work. The programme, which consisted of a pianoforte solo by Mrs. Lundius, songs by Mesdames Eckoff, Willis, and Bird, and Mr. J. Ha'nna, and a novelty instrumental item, by Mr. Routhwaite, was greatly enjoyed. The accompanists were Mesdames Shepherd,' Buddie, and Carey. , A competition was won by Mrs. Fyfe and Miss Mori, after which a delicious tea was served.
